Oakmoss
An earthy, forest-floor note historically essential to classic "chypre" perfumery.
Origin
A lichen that grows on oak trees, primarily harvested in the Balkans and France; usage is now regulated in fine fragrance due to allergen concerns, so modern versions are often reformulated.
Character
Damp, earthy, and slightly bitter with a forest-floor quality — traditionally the anchor of chypre fragrances alongside bergamot and labdanum.
